Tin Occurrences Associated with the Ohio Creek Pluton, Chulitna Region, South-Central Alaska

In 1984 and 1985 the Bureau of Mines mapped and sampled reported tin occurrences associated with the Ohio Creek pluton, in the central Alaska Range, south-central Alaska. The pluton is a composite intrusion with a core of moderately coarse-grained biotite granite and an outer zone of finer-grained leucocratic muscovite granite. Tin mineralization, associated with silver, base-metal, and tungsten values, occurs within the muscovite granite as cassiterite (SnO2) within both quartz-muscovite greisen and arsenopyrite veins. Silver occurs within argentiferous galena and argentite (Ag2S); tungsten is present in the Mn-rich wolframite mineral huebnerite (MnWO4). Metallurgical testing of three large samples of tin mineralized greisen showed tin recoveries of 27-64% in table concentrates. A low-grade zone near the pluton's upper contact is inferred to contain a resource of approximately 1,250,000 lb Sn.
